| Local air quality was monitored in Francis Street, Yarraville for 142 days from late March to early August 2002. The same site was monitored during a comparable, but shorter period in 2001. Overall, the particle concentrations in 2002 were lower than those in 2001. The lower particle concentrations measured at Francis Street during July 2002 compared to July 2001 are most likely to be influenced by different weather conditions, in particular wind speed, rather than the effect of the truck curfew introduced in April 2002. | |
